Output 20bb90ca816798558b42b4a677b6eff347cc19c7442a0649260e0f78e7f98f9b:1

value
12008067
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 003dd585960285b12b9090ece6ae84ff3f59d372 OP_EQUALVERIFY OP_CHECKSIG
address
112H5Jmz7Wjba7r3DqHY5f18JyRWL5bNEe
transaction
20bb90ca816798558b42b4a677b6eff347cc19c7442a0649260e0f78e7f98f9b
confirmations
278316
spent
true